SlideShare a Scribd company logo
Widgets, Mobile Apps and Mashups
Karen A. Coombs
Widgets
• WorldCat Widget
  • WorldCat keyword search widget
  • WorldCat search widget


• Embeddable Database widgets
  • EBSCO, Proquest, JSTOR Facebook


• Google Widgets
  • Embedded Preview - http://code.google.com/apis/books/docs/preview-
    wizard.html
• LibraryThing Widgets
  • http://www.librarything.com/widget.php
Widget Workshop
Widget Workshop
Widget Workshop
Widget Workshop
Embeddable Database Widgets
Widget Workshop
Widget Workshop
Simple Mobile Apps

• Wordpress plugins for iPhone


• Wordpress plugin for Mobile devices


• xFruits RSS to Mobile - http://xfruits.com/


• Google Books - http://books.google.com/m


• WorldCat.org mobile - http://www.worldcat.org/m
Widget Workshop
Widget Workshop
Widget Workshop
Widget Workshop
Widget Workshop
Widget Workshop
Libraries with Mobile Initiatives

• NCSU


   • WolfWalk - http://www.lib.ncsu.edu/dli/projects/wolfwalk/


• University of Virginia - http://www2.lib.virginia.edu/mobile/


• Skokie Public Library - http://www.skokielibrary.info/s_about/
  mobile_services.asp#alerts


• DCPL iPhone App - http://dclibrarylabs.org/projects/iphone/


• Oregon State University Libraries - http://osulibrary.oregonstate.edu/
  about_mobile
Creating Mashups with Yahoo Pipes

• Web based service which allows you to process, filter and mashup data from
  different sources


• Data sources


  • Feed, CSV, Data (in XML format), Flickr, Google Base, etc.


• Output


  • RSS, JSON, iGoogle Widget, MyYahoo Widget, Embeddable Javascript
Feed Remixing

• Want to pull together RSS and/or Atom feeds from a variety of sources and
  filter and repurpose them


• Possible data sources


  • Database search results


  • catalog search results


  • Journal Table of Contents


  • Blogs


  • Lists for resources from WorldCat
Making your data mashable
• Lo-fi API


  • RSS/Atom feed


• Use systems with APIs


  • Drupal, Silverstripe


• Build systems with APIs


  • University of Houston website API


  • Use data in lots of different applications


  • Page metadata, staff, hours
API Calls

 http://staging2.lib.uh.edu/api/?
 format=html&component=c.hours&metho
 d=displayToday

 http://staging2.lib.uh.edu/api/?
 format=json&component=c.hours&metho
 d=displayToday
<h2 id="todayHours">Today's Hours</h2>
<script src="http://staging2.lib.uh.edu/api/api.js" /
>
<script src="http://staging2.lib.uh.edu/api/?
format=json&component=c.hours&method=display
Today&callback=displayTodaysHours" type="text/
javascript" />

More Related Content

PDF
Library Mashups: What's New
PPTX
It summit2015
PPTX
Exposing Library Content with the NISO Metasearch XML Gateway Protocol
PPTX
Too Late for the Library Catalog? Inconceivable!
PDF
Deluca "Building Momentum and Support for Institutional Repository Deposits"
PPTX
NCompass Live: Beyond MARC: BIBFRAME and the Future of Bibliographic Data
PDF
December 2, 2015: NISO/NFAIS Virtual Conference: Semantic Web: What's New and...
Library Mashups: What's New
It summit2015
Exposing Library Content with the NISO Metasearch XML Gateway Protocol
Too Late for the Library Catalog? Inconceivable!
Deluca "Building Momentum and Support for Institutional Repository Deposits"
NCompass Live: Beyond MARC: BIBFRAME and the Future of Bibliographic Data
December 2, 2015: NISO/NFAIS Virtual Conference: Semantic Web: What's New and...

What's hot (8)

PPTX
Dulin PermaCC Talk for MIT PIS
PPTX
The Power of Sharing Linked Data: Bibliothekartag 2014
PPTX
Assessing Your Library Website: Using User Research Methods and Other Tools
PDF
Customizing Discovery at the University of Michigan
PPTX
Ham api-it-summit 2015-06-05
PDF
Consuming Linked Data by Humans - WWW2010
PPTX
Linked Open Data and Digital Curation (Islandora)
Dulin PermaCC Talk for MIT PIS
The Power of Sharing Linked Data: Bibliothekartag 2014
Assessing Your Library Website: Using User Research Methods and Other Tools
Customizing Discovery at the University of Michigan
Ham api-it-summit 2015-06-05
Consuming Linked Data by Humans - WWW2010
Linked Open Data and Digital Curation (Islandora)
Ad

Viewers also liked (7)

PDF
Real Life Experiences With Library APIS
KEY
Open Source CMS Playroom
PDF
Freedom of the Seas
PPT
كيفية إضافة كاتب مساهم إلى مدونتك
KEY
Drupal Open Source Everything
KEY
IFLA 2009 Web Cast - Creating a Successful Internet Presence
PPT
مشاهدة زيارات صفحتي
Real Life Experiences With Library APIS
Open Source CMS Playroom
Freedom of the Seas
كيفية إضافة كاتب مساهم إلى مدونتك
Drupal Open Source Everything
IFLA 2009 Web Cast - Creating a Successful Internet Presence
مشاهدة زيارات صفحتي
Ad

Similar to Widget Workshop (20)

PPT
Sticking between: mashup in libraries
KEY
Library Mashups & APIs
PPTX
Doing More with Less: Mash Your Way to Productivity
PPTX
Doing More with Less: Mash Your Way to Productivity
PDF
Mash-Up Personal Learning Environments (MUPPLE)
PPT
Customization For Libraries
PPT
411 on Mashups
PPT
Mashups for Libraries
PDF
Library Mashups: What's New
PPT
Library Mashups
PPT
IWMW 2008 Mashup Workshop
KEY
Web 30 and RSS
PPT
PPT
The scripting library: Combining data and information in the library
ODP
Web2.0 2012 - lesson 7 - technologies and mashups
PPT
Web 2.0
PPT
Web20 Intro Naj Shaik
PPT
Web 2.0 Mashups
PDF
Library Hacks
KEY
Approaches to mobile site development
Sticking between: mashup in libraries
Library Mashups & APIs
Doing More with Less: Mash Your Way to Productivity
Doing More with Less: Mash Your Way to Productivity
Mash-Up Personal Learning Environments (MUPPLE)
Customization For Libraries
411 on Mashups
Mashups for Libraries
Library Mashups: What's New
Library Mashups
IWMW 2008 Mashup Workshop
Web 30 and RSS
The scripting library: Combining data and information in the library
Web2.0 2012 - lesson 7 - technologies and mashups
Web 2.0
Web20 Intro Naj Shaik
Web 2.0 Mashups
Library Hacks
Approaches to mobile site development

Recently uploaded (20)

PDF
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
PDF
Machine learning based COVID-19 study performance prediction
PPTX
Effective Security Operations Center (SOC) A Modern, Strategic, and Threat-In...
DOCX
The AUB Centre for AI in Media Proposal.docx
PDF
Network Security Unit 5.pdf for BCA BBA.
PDF
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
PDF
KodekX | Application Modernization Development
PDF
Agricultural_Statistics_at_a_Glance_2022_0.pdf
PDF
Mobile App Security Testing_ A Comprehensive Guide.pdf
PPTX
Programs and apps: productivity, graphics, security and other tools
PPTX
MYSQL Presentation for SQL database connectivity
PPTX
Cloud computing and distributed systems.
PPTX
Digital-Transformation-Roadmap-for-Companies.pptx
PDF
Diabetes mellitus diagnosis method based random forest with bat algorithm
PPTX
VMware vSphere Foundation How to Sell Presentation-Ver1.4-2-14-2024.pptx
PDF
Reach Out and Touch Someone: Haptics and Empathic Computing
PDF
Chapter 3 Spatial Domain Image Processing.pdf
PDF
Unlocking AI with Model Context Protocol (MCP)
PDF
MIND Revenue Release Quarter 2 2025 Press Release
PDF
Optimiser vos workloads AI/ML sur Amazon EC2 et AWS Graviton
TokAI - TikTok AI Agent : The First AI Application That Analyzes 10,000+ Vira...
Machine learning based COVID-19 study performance prediction
Effective Security Operations Center (SOC) A Modern, Strategic, and Threat-In...
The AUB Centre for AI in Media Proposal.docx
Network Security Unit 5.pdf for BCA BBA.
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
KodekX | Application Modernization Development
Agricultural_Statistics_at_a_Glance_2022_0.pdf
Mobile App Security Testing_ A Comprehensive Guide.pdf
Programs and apps: productivity, graphics, security and other tools
MYSQL Presentation for SQL database connectivity
Cloud computing and distributed systems.
Digital-Transformation-Roadmap-for-Companies.pptx
Diabetes mellitus diagnosis method based random forest with bat algorithm
VMware vSphere Foundation How to Sell Presentation-Ver1.4-2-14-2024.pptx
Reach Out and Touch Someone: Haptics and Empathic Computing
Chapter 3 Spatial Domain Image Processing.pdf
Unlocking AI with Model Context Protocol (MCP)
MIND Revenue Release Quarter 2 2025 Press Release
Optimiser vos workloads AI/ML sur Amazon EC2 et AWS Graviton

Widget Workshop

  • 1. Widgets, Mobile Apps and Mashups Karen A. Coombs
  • 2. Widgets • WorldCat Widget • WorldCat keyword search widget • WorldCat search widget • Embeddable Database widgets • EBSCO, Proquest, JSTOR Facebook • Google Widgets • Embedded Preview - http://code.google.com/apis/books/docs/preview- wizard.html • LibraryThing Widgets • http://www.librarything.com/widget.php
  • 10. Simple Mobile Apps • Wordpress plugins for iPhone • Wordpress plugin for Mobile devices • xFruits RSS to Mobile - http://xfruits.com/ • Google Books - http://books.google.com/m • WorldCat.org mobile - http://www.worldcat.org/m
  • 17. Libraries with Mobile Initiatives • NCSU • WolfWalk - http://www.lib.ncsu.edu/dli/projects/wolfwalk/ • University of Virginia - http://www2.lib.virginia.edu/mobile/ • Skokie Public Library - http://www.skokielibrary.info/s_about/ mobile_services.asp#alerts • DCPL iPhone App - http://dclibrarylabs.org/projects/iphone/ • Oregon State University Libraries - http://osulibrary.oregonstate.edu/ about_mobile
  • 18. Creating Mashups with Yahoo Pipes • Web based service which allows you to process, filter and mashup data from different sources • Data sources • Feed, CSV, Data (in XML format), Flickr, Google Base, etc. • Output • RSS, JSON, iGoogle Widget, MyYahoo Widget, Embeddable Javascript
  • 19. Feed Remixing • Want to pull together RSS and/or Atom feeds from a variety of sources and filter and repurpose them • Possible data sources • Database search results • catalog search results • Journal Table of Contents • Blogs • Lists for resources from WorldCat
  • 20. Making your data mashable • Lo-fi API • RSS/Atom feed • Use systems with APIs • Drupal, Silverstripe • Build systems with APIs • University of Houston website API • Use data in lots of different applications • Page metadata, staff, hours
  • 21. API Calls http://staging2.lib.uh.edu/api/? format=html&component=c.hours&metho d=displayToday http://staging2.lib.uh.edu/api/? format=json&component=c.hours&metho d=displayToday
  • 22. <h2 id="todayHours">Today's Hours</h2> <script src="http://staging2.lib.uh.edu/api/api.js" / > <script src="http://staging2.lib.uh.edu/api/? format=json&component=c.hours&method=display Today&callback=displayTodaysHours" type="text/ javascript" />